全部博文(36)
分类: 系统运维
2011-08-15 15:21:08
一,YUM问题
在使用YUM进行安装等操作的时候,会出现如下信息:
Loading "installonlyn" plugin
Setting up repositories
core [1/3]
Cannot find a valid baseurl for repo: core
Error: Cannot find a valid baseurl for repo: core
或者出现
extras [2/3]
Cannot find a valid baseurl for repo: extras
Error: Cannot find a valid baseurl for repo: extras
或者
updates [3/3]
Cannot find a valid baseurl for repo: updates
Error: Cannot find a valid baseurl for repo: updates
网上通报的有两种方法
方法一:
1. 升级yum.conf
# mv /etc/yum.conf /otherpath/back
2. 下载配置文件
# wget
3.升级yum
#rpm -Uvh
注:这种方法我试过了,好像不行,还是看下一种吧。
方法二:
1.进入/etc/yum.repos.d目录下。
fedora-core.repo,fedora-extras.repo,fedora-updates.repo
2.用gedit等打开以上文件,将[core],[extras],[updates]下的baseurl前的#去掉,如:
#baseurl=前的#号
3.更改三个文件的部分内容:
fedora-core.repo 里的#baseurl=/$releasever/$basearch/os/ 改为:baseurl=
fedora-extras.repo 里的
#baseurl= 改为:baseurl=
fedora-updates.repo 里的
#baseurl=/updates/$releasever/$basearch/ 改为:baseurl=
其他参考资料:
http://blog.chinaunix.net/space.php?uid=609478&do=blog&cuid=1950510
二,点击“添加/删除软件信息”或者“软件包管理”出现“另一个程序正在运行并在访问软件信息”
1 在服务(services)里把yum-updates取消估计就不会出现这个问题了。
2 pkill yum或者是pkill yum-update, 然后再安装RPM包就可以了,他是开机自动加载了yum
3 chkconfig yum-updatesd off ; service yum-updatesd stop
4 打开 /var/run/yum.pid 记下这个数字 运行 sudo kuill xxxx(刚才的pid)
三,Eclipse问题
在Linux下安装运行Eclipse出现如下错误,failed to load the jni shared library"/opt/jdk1.6.0_23/bin/../jre/lib/i386/client/libjvm.so"
解决方法:关闭selinux即可解决。
# vi /etc/sysconfig/selinux
修改:SELINUX=enforcing 为:SELINUX=disable 禁用SeLinux, 再重启运行就可以了。